Dyed Viscose Poplin Fabric

This is a dyed poplin woven fabric made from 100% viscose artificial filament yarn, weighing around 120 gsm with a non-square plain weave construction featuring more warp ends than filling picks per cm. It qualifies under HTS 5408.32.90.20 as poplin or broadcloth due to its specific weave and weight characteristics excluding selvage, distinguishing it from sheeting or printcloth. Primarily used for blouses and linings.

Alternative Classifications

This product could be classified differently depending on its characteristics or intended use.

5407.61Lower: 24.9% vs 50%

If made from synthetic filament yarn like polyester

Synthetic filaments (e.g., polyester) fall under heading 5407, while artificial (e.g., viscose) are in 5408.

5408.33.90.20Lower: 47% vs 50%

If yarns are of different colors (not uniformly dyed)

Yarn-dyed fabrics shift to 5408.33, as dyeing is applied to yarns before weaving rather than the finished fabric.

5408.34.90.40Lower: 47% vs 50%

If printed with patterns or designs

Printed woven fabrics are classified under 5408.34, separate from plain dyed poplin or broadcloth.

Import Tips & Compliance

Verify fabric weight under 170 gsm and non-square construction via lab testing to confirm poplin classification and avoid reclassification as sheeting

Provide mill certificates detailing yarn type (artificial filament), dye process, and weave specs for CBP review
